Advance Device Lock PRO FAQs Activation/Installation | Upgrade | Use | Important Notes Activation/Installation of Advance Device Lock PRO  | I have purchased a license, how can I activate the application? | Top | | | If you have on-device internet connection, please open the application and select “Activate” from the application main menu.
Then just follow the instructions.If you do not have on-device internet connection, please use the manual activation method: download your license file from the link we have sent you via e-mail upon purchase. | |  | The application cannot be installed on the removable media (memory card). Why is that so? | Top | | | Allowing the application to install on removable drives leads to security problems. Removing the installation drive causes the device to unlock. | |  | Is my license valid forever? | Top | | | The full license unlocks the application for unlimited use but only on the device it is generated for. | |  | Can I transfer my license to another device? | Top | | | The license file is based on the unique IMEI number of your device and can be used exclusively on the device it is purchased for. | |  | How can I check whether my application has been activated? | Top | | | Open the “About” menu from the main “Options” menu - it states either “Not registered” or “Licensed to IMEI xxxxxxxxxxxxxxx”. | |  | I got "Certificate Error" when trying to activate the application manually on my Nokia E*. How can I resolve this? | Top | | | Please, go to Tools → Application Manager → Options → Settings → Software Installation and select “All” before installing the license. | |  | I got "Expired certificate" when trying to activate the application manually | Top | | | Please re-download the license file from our server. If the problem persists, please check the current date of your device and correct it if necessary. | |  | What is IMEI? | Top | | | The IMEI (International Mobile Equipment Identity) is a unique 15-digit code used to identify an individual GSM mobile station to a GSM network. You can retrieve your IMEI number by typing *#06# on your phone. As an alternative your IMEI number is written on the back of your phone (under the battery). | |  | If I format my device will my license be lost? | Top | | | You can anytime (re)activate your application. If you format your device, just install the application again (the latest versions are available on our website: www.1voiz.com ) and press ‘Activate’ to retrieve your license as it is stored on our servers. | |  | I have installed the license successfully but the application is still in a trial mode. | Top | | | Please exit the application and start it again. | |  | Is ADL Pro compatible with S60 touch-screen devices? | Top | | | Yes, ADL Pro supports S60 touch-screen devices. You can download the application from here. | |  | I receive "Expired Certificate" when I try to install your software on my Nokia 5800. | Top | | | “Expired certificate” error message occurs when you try to install .sis or .sisx files on Nokia 5800 devices with firmware older than 11.x.xxx.
A possible solution is to backup all messages, notes, calendar entries, and contacts via Nokia PC Suite, remove the microSD memory card, format your Nokia 5800 and move the back-up items back on your device. | |
